Votes at a glance: License Committee forwards two temporary alcohol permits to council

License Committee · August 10, 2026

Summary

At its meeting the License Committee approved recommendations to forward two temporary alcohol-service applications — Greene County House premise extension and Monroe Lions Club temporary Class B license for the Fall Nationals — to the Common Council; both motions passed by recorded ayes with one member absent for the meeting.

The License Committee approved two separate motions to forward temporary alcohol-service permits to the Common Council.

For the Greene County House premises-extension application the committee approved a motion to move the item to council; the clerk recorded aye votes from Alders Vestine, Tolman and Valkley and recorded Alder Mosher as not present earlier in the meeting. For the Monroe Lions Club temporary Class B license (tied to the Greene County Fall Nationals), the committee approved forwarding the application; the clerk recorded aye votes from Alders Tolman, Boeckley and Westin and recorded Alder Mosher as absent.

Both motions were recorded as approved and no amendments or additional conditions were placed on the record by the committee. The items will next be considered by the Common Council.
